Chandogya Upanishad 8.12Famous

एवमेवैष सम्प्रसादोऽस्माच्छरीरात्समुत्थाय परं ज्योतिरुपसम्पद्य स्वेन रूपेणाभिनिष्पद्यते। एष आत्मेति होवाचैतदमृतमभयमेतद्ब्रह्मेति। तस्य ह वा एतस्य ब्रह्मणो नाम सत्यमिति॥
evamevaiṣa samprasādo\'smāccharīrātsamutthāya paraṃ jyotirupasампadya svena rūpeṇābhiniṣpadyate | eṣa ātmeti hovācaitadamṛtamabhayametadbrahmeti | tasya ha vā etasya brahmaṇo nāma satyamiti ||
"Thus this serene being, rising from this body, reaches the highest light and appears in its own form. This is the Self - immortal, fearless. This is Brahman. The name of this Brahman is Satya (Truth/Reality)."
What This Means:
The serene Self rises from the body, reaches the highest light, and appears in its true form. This immortal, fearless Self is Brahman. Its name is Truth.
Going Deeper:
Samprasada = serene consciousness. Upon liberation, it reveals its true nature (svarupa) as the highest light. Brahman = Satya (Reality).
